Brazil, Postage Due Stamp, 1946

Brazil · 1946 · 20c

This is a postage due stamp, indicated by the large numeral '20' at its center, representing the amount to be collected upon delivery. The design is simple and functional, featuring the denomination prominently, with the country name 'BRASIL' and 'CORREIO' (Post) above, and 'TAXA DEVIDA' (Tax Due) below.

Issued in the post-World War II era, this stamp was part of a series used to collect insufficient postage from the recipient of a letter, a common postal practice of the time.
